An animated series (''Chiisana Baikingu Bikke'' in Japan, and ''Wickie und die Starken Männer'' in Germany) was made as an InternationalCoproduction between Germany's Taurus Film and Japan's Zuiyo Eizo (which became Creator/NipponAnimation during the series' run) in 1974. It lasted for 78 episodes on ZDF in Germany and Creator/FujiTelevision in Japan, and has been adapted into many languages, including Spanish, French, Italian, Polish, Arabic, Dutch, Portuguese and (naturally) Swedish. The French dub is much-loved in Canada, where it aired on [[Creator/{{CBC}} Radio-Canada]] and was later rerun on Télé-Québec and Creator/{{Teletoon}}.

* LittleStowaway: In episode 1, Halvar, chief of the Vikings of Flake, promises his son Vicky to take him along on their next raiding cruise if Vicky can beat him in a footrace/stone carrying competition. When Vicky succeeds very much against Halvar's expectation, Halvar is in a quandary because he knows that the other Vikings are against taking Vicky on board. As a solution, in episode 2 Vicky suggests for Halvar to smuggle him aboard in a barrel, so he can later pretend he did not know that Vicky was on the ship. This works, and when Vicky is finally discovered, Halvar feigns surprise and indignation, but persuades the crew to take him along rather than to lose time by turning back. Meanwhile, Vicky's friend Ylvie, who has got wind of Vicky's plan, tries to join him by hiding in another barrel, but is found out before the ship departs.
